#1acf00 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1acf00 is composed of 10.2% red, 81.2%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 112.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 40.6%. #1acf00 color hex could be obtained by blending #34ff00 with #009f00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#1acf00

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b00 is the darkest color, while #f7fff6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1acf00

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626f60 is the less saturated color, while #1acf00 is the most saturated one.
